John Marino <binutils@marino.st> writes:
> 1. incremental_test: suspect this is not really an error (failed v2.21 too)
It does pass on GNU/Linux, but it's not an interesting test case at this
point.
> 2. ver_matching_test.sh: __bss_start not local, rtld issue? real issue? (failed on v2.21 too)
Hard to understand why this would fail. The __bss_start symbol is
defined automatically by the linker itself.
> 3. exception_static_test: likely real problem. gdb log attached
My first guess would be that DragonFly does not support dl_iterate_phdr,
or that it does not work correctly for statically linked executables.
That's just a guess, though.
> 4. intpri2: likely real problem. gdb log attached
This is almost certainly the same issue as the --no-ctors-in-init-array
issue: DragonFly does not suppor DT_INIT_ARRAY.
> 5. relro_test: no relro support in rtld, ignore
> 6. relro_now_test: no relro support in rtld, ignore
> 7. relro_strip_test: no relro support in rtld, ignore
Yeah, if the dynamic linker does not handle relro, then these tests are
expected to fail.
